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Varejo Gestão Fiscal

Linha de Produto:

Linha Fiscal Manager 

Segmento:

Varejo 

Módulo:

DOCUMENTO FISCAL

Função:FISCAL MANAGER
País:Brasil
Ticket:Ticket #17681705
Requisito/Story/Issue (informe o requisito relacionado) :DVARLVN-9153


02. SITUAÇÃO/REQUISITO

Implementar novos campos e Regras de Validação da NFC-e, NT 2023.001V1.20, no Fiscal Manager.

03. SOLUÇÃO

  • Inclusão do Campo de Índice de Mistura do Biodiesel no Diesel B (tag: pBio)


Exemplo Json:


"detalheProduto": [{
		...
		"combustivel": {
			"cProdANP": "Código de produto da ANP",
			"descANP": "Descrição do produto conforme ANP",
			"ufCons": "Sigla da UF de consumo",
			"encerrante": {
				"nBico": "Número de identificação do bico utilizado no abastecimento",
				"nBomba": "Número de identificação da bomba ao qual o bico está interligado",
				"nTanque": "Número de identificação do tanque ao qual o bico está interligado",
				"vEncIni": "Valor do Encerrante no início do abastecimento",
				"vEncFin": "Valor do Encerrante no final do abastecimento"
			},
			"pBio": "Percentual do índice de mistura do Biodiesel (B100) no Óleo Diesel B instituído pelo órgão regulamentador"
		}
}]



  • Inclusão do Grupo indicador da origem do combustível (tag: origComb)


Exemplo Json:

"detalheProduto": [{
		...
		"combustivel": {
			...
			},
			"origComb": {
				"indImport": "Indicador de importação",
				"cUFOrig": "Código da UF",
				"pOrig": "Percentual originário para a UF"
			}
		}
}]



  • Criação do Grupo N02a- Grupo Tributação do ICMS = 02 (tag: ICMS02)


Exemplo Json:

"imposto": {
	...
	"icms": {
		"icms02": {
			"orig": Origem da mercadoria,
			"cst": "Tributação do ICMS",
			"qBCMono": Quantidade tributada,
			"adRemICMS": Alíquota ad rem do imposto,
			"vICMSMono": Valor do ICMS próprio
		}
	}
}    



  • Criação do Grupo N03a- Grupo Tributação do ICMS = 15 (tag: ICMS15)


Exemplo Json:

"imposto": {
	...
	"icms": {
		"icms15": {
			"orig": Origem da mercadoria,
			"cst": "Tributação do ICMS",
			"qBCMono": Quantidade tributada,
			"adRemICMS": Alíquota ad rem do imposto,
			"vICMSMono": Valor do ICMS próprio,
			"qBCMonoReten": Quantidade tributada sujeita a retenção,
			"adRemICMSReten": Alíquota ad rem do imposto com retenção,
			"vICMSMonoReten": Valor do ICMS com retenção,
			"pRedAdRem": Percentual de redução do valor da alíquota adrem do ICMS,
			"motRedAdRem": "Motivo da redução do adrem"
		}

	}

}  



  • Criação do Grupo N07a- Grupo Tributação do ICMS = 53 (tag: ICMS53)


Exemplo Json:

"imposto": {
	...
	"icms": {
		"icms53": {
			"orig": Origem da mercadoria,
			"cst": "Tributação do ICMS",
			"qBCMono": Quantidade Tributada,
			"adRemICMS": Alíquota adRem do imposto,
			"vICMSMonoOp": Valor do ICMS da operação,
			"pDif": Percentual do diferimento,
			"vICMSMonoDif": Valor do ICMS diferido,
			"vICMSMono": Valor do ICMS próprio devido
		}
	}
}  



  • Criação do Grupo N08a- Grupo Tributação do ICMS = 61 (tag: ICMS61)


Exemplo Json:

"imposto": {
	...
	"icms": {
		"icms61": {
			"orig": Origem da mercadoria,
			"cst": "Tributação do ICMS",
			"qBCMonoRet": Quantidade tributada retida anteriormente,
			"adRemICMSRet": Alíquota ad rem do imposto retido anteriormente,
			"vICMSMonoRet": Valor do ICMS retido anteriormente
		}
	}
}  



  • Criação dos campos de Valor total do ICMS monofásico


Exemplo Json:

	"total": {
		"icmsTotal": {
			...
			"qbcMono":0.0,
			"vicmsMono":0.0,
			"qbcMonoReten":0.0,
			"vICMSMonoReten":0.0,
			"qbcMonoRet":0.0,
			"vICMSMonoRet":0.0
		}



04. DEMAIS INFORMAÇÕES

Segue NT 2023.001V1.20



05. ASSUNTOS RELACIONADOS